How Dangerous Is Sleep disorder From AZATHIOPRINE?

Of the 695 reports, 602 (86.6%) resulted in death, 552 (79.4%) required hospitalization, and 519 (74.7%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Sleep disorder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for AZATHIOPRINE. However, 695 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
